Précédent   Forum des professionnels en informatique > PHP > Langage > Sessions
Sessions Forum d'entraide sur les sessions avec PHP. Avant de poster -> FAQ sessions, Cours sessions et Sources sécurité
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 19/03/2007, 17h59   #1
Invité de passage
 
Inscription : janvier 2004
Messages : 19
Détails du profil
Informations forums :
Inscription : janvier 2004
Messages : 19
Points : 0
Points : 0
Par défaut Problème récupération identifiant

Bonjour à tous

Voilà j'ai un petit souci j'ai deux fichier php, le premier effectue un session_start() et affecte la variable:

$_SESSION["CLIENT"]=$CLIENT;
$CLIENT est bien alimenté (c'est sûr).

Si je fais un echo $_SESSION["CLIENT"] un peu plus bas dans la page, le contenu s'affiche bien. Quand je change de page, sur la page 2, je fais un session_start(); en haut de page et puis un echo $_SESSION["CLIENT"] . il n'affiche rien du tout.
Si je vais dans mon rep de sessions php session.privatedir je vois que 2 fichiers de session ont été crées le premier est bien alimenté et le second est vide.

Si j'actualise la page 2 alors j'ai un fichier de session crée a chaque actualisation. Aurais-je oublié un paramètre dans le php.ini ???

merci d'avance!
smazaudi est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/03/2007, 22h18   #2
Membre éprouvé
 
Homme
Inscription : mai 2006
Messages : 694
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 31
Localisation : Belgique

Informations forums :
Inscription : mai 2006
Messages : 694
Points : 417
Points : 417
Salut,

En effet ce n'est pas normal ce que tu dis là. Pourrais-tu donner la partie de ton php.ini concernant les sessions?
__________________
Pensez au tag
webrider est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 26/03/2007, 23h03   #3
Invité régulier
 
Inscription : mars 2007
Messages : 18
Détails du profil
Informations personnelles :
Localisation : France, Paris (Île de France)

Informations forums :
Inscription : mars 2007
Messages : 18
Points : 9
Points : 9
si tu as rien touché dans le php.ini ya pas de raison que ca marche pas.

tu as bien autorisé les sessions dans le navigateur ?

c est tout bete je sais mais parfois c est des petits truc comme ca...
metos00 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 27/03/2007, 11h57   #4
Membre actif
 
Avatar de bigltnt
 
Inscription : mars 2007
Messages : 221
Détails du profil
Informations personnelles :
Âge : 27

Informations forums :
Inscription : mars 2007
Messages : 221
Points : 155
Points : 155
Salut !

Pour commencer, as-tu bien les cookies d'activés dans ton navigateur (sinon faut pas chercher plus loin).

Ensuite je sais pas si ca va changer quelque chose, mais préfère les simples quote aux doubles pour les identifiants, pour eviter une intérprétation frauduleuse. Je m'explique:

Code :
1
2
3
session_start();
$CLIENT='taguada';
$_SESSION['CLIENT']=$CLIENT;
et ensuite sur la prochaine page:
Code :
1
2
session_start();
echo $_SESSION['CLIENT'];
Voila. Des fois c'est tout bête mais un simple quote de travers et php perd les pédales (le pire c'est dans les requêtes sql ... ).

Voila j'espère ca va changer quelque chose a ton problème. Bon courage ++
bigltnt est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 27/03/2007, 12h52   #5
Expert Confirmé
 
Avatar de trotters213
 
Inscription : janvier 2005
Messages : 2 572
Détails du profil
Informations personnelles :
Âge : 26
Localisation : France, Gard (Languedoc Roussillon)

Informations forums :
Inscription : janvier 2005
Messages : 2 572
Points : 2 605
Points : 2 605

Tu démarres bien ta session avant tout autre code qui puisse écrire du HTML ?

Jette peut-être dans la FAQ de Cyberzoïde.

Si ton problème n'est toujours pas résolu, tu pourrais nous montrer tes 2 pages de codes ?
__________________
Pensez au tag
Les règles du Forum

Dev. Web : FAQ (X)HTML/CSS | Tutos (X)HTML | Tutos CSS

PHP : FAQ PHP | Tutos PHP | Benchmark PHP 5

SQL : Cours SQL
trotters213 est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 09h47.


 
 
 
 
Partenaires

Hébergement Web